**GCC Physical Therapy Equipment Market Drivers**

**Increasing Prevalence of Chronic Diseases**

The GCC region has seen a significant rise in chronic diseases such as diabetes, obesity, and cardiovascular disorders, which demand physical therapy for management and recovery. The World Health Organization reported that the prevalence of diabetes in the Gulf Cooperation Council countries has risen to approximately 16% in recent years.

Moreover, the Ministry of Health in Saudi Arabia indicated that over 4 million individuals are currently living with diabetes, which correlates directly to increased demand for physical therapy services and equipment.As more healthcare facilities adopt modern rehabilitation practices, the GCC Physical Therapy Equipment Market Industry is expected to expand, driven by increased patient intake for rehabilitation services.

**Government Initiatives to Improve Healthcare Infrastructure**

In the GCC, various governments are actively investing in healthcare infrastructure due to the Vision 2030 initiatives set forth in countries like Saudi Arabia and the UAE. These initiatives aim to enhance the quality of healthcare services, which include expanding physical therapy services. 
For instance, the GCC states aim to increase healthcare spending to 20% of their GDP by 2030, thereby enhancing access to physical therapy and promoting awareness about rehabilitation services.As a result, the GCC Physical Therapy Equipment Market Industry is positioned for growth as more healthcare facilities are established and equipped with advanced physical therapy technology.

**Rising Elderly Population**

The aging population in the GCC is a major driver for the physical therapy equipment market. According to the United Nations, the percentage of individuals aged 65 years and older in Gulf countries is expected to increase from 3.5% in 2020 to over 12% by 2030. This demographic shift will lead to higher demand for rehabilitation services, as older adults frequently experience mobility issues and other age-related health challenges.

Established organizations such as the GCC Health Ministers' Council are promoting geriatric healthcare, which emphasizes rehabilitation and physical therapy as crucial components.Thus, the GCC Physical Therapy Equipment Market Industry is anticipated to grow in response to the needs of an aging population.

## Market Drivers

### Government Initiatives and Funding

Government initiatives aimed at enhancing healthcare infrastructure in the GCC are likely to bolster the physical therapy-equipment market. Various national health strategies emphasize the importance of rehabilitation services, leading to increased funding for physical therapy programs. For instance, the allocation of $1 billion towards healthcare improvements in the UAE has been reported, which includes investments in physical therapy facilities and equipment. Such financial support not only enhances accessibility to therapy services but also encourages the adoption of innovative equipment, thus driving market expansion.

### Technological Integration in Healthcare

The integration of advanced technologies such as telehealth and wearable devices into rehabilitation practices is transforming the physical therapy-equipment market. In the GCC, healthcare providers are increasingly adopting digital solutions to enhance patient engagement and treatment outcomes. For example, the use of tele-rehabilitation has shown a 40% improvement in patient adherence to therapy regimens. This technological shift not only improves the efficiency of therapy but also drives the demand for innovative equipment that can support these new modalities, thereby expanding the market.

### Rising Sports Participation and Injuries

The growing participation in sports and physical activities across the GCC is contributing to an increase in sports-related injuries, which in turn drives the demand for physical therapy equipment. With a surge in fitness awareness and organized sports events, the incidence of injuries requiring rehabilitation is on the rise. Reports indicate that sports injuries account for approximately 15% of all injuries in the region. Consequently, this trend necessitates the availability of specialized equipment for effective recovery, thereby propelling the physical therapy-equipment market.

### Increasing Prevalence of Chronic Conditions

The rising incidence of chronic conditions such as arthritis, diabetes, and cardiovascular diseases in the GCC region is a significant driver for the physical therapy-equipment market. As the population ages and lifestyle-related health issues become more prevalent, the demand for rehabilitation services and associated equipment is expected to grow. According to recent health statistics, approximately 30% of the adult population in GCC countries suffers from at least one chronic condition, necessitating ongoing physical therapy. This trend indicates a sustained need for advanced therapeutic equipment to support recovery and improve quality of life, thereby propelling market growth.

### Growing Awareness of Rehabilitation Benefits

There is a notable increase in public awareness regarding the benefits of rehabilitation and physical therapy, which is positively influencing the physical therapy-equipment market. Educational campaigns and community health programs in the GCC have highlighted the importance of physical therapy in recovery and injury prevention. This heightened awareness is reflected in a 25% increase in the number of patients seeking physical therapy services over the past year. As more individuals recognize the value of rehabilitation, the demand for specialized equipment is expected to rise, further stimulating market growth.
